Title of article :
Wannier–Mott excitons formed by electrons in a quantum wire and holes in a perpendicular quantum layer

Abstract :
We analyze Wannier–Mott excitons in which the electrons are constrained in one-dimensional quantum wires and the holes in two-dimensional quantum layers perpendicular to the wires. The resulting three-dimensional exciton Schrödinger equation in the laboratory frame of reference is solved in terms of the common 3D exciton states in the center of mass frame.
